Sliding Patio Door Repair Questions
Why is my sliding patio door difficult to open? The door may have debris in the track, worn rollers, or misalignment issues that hinder smooth operation.
How can I tell if my sliding door needs repair? Signs include sticking, difficulty locking, drafts, or visible damage to the frame or rollers.
What causes a sliding patio door to fall off its track? Wear and tear on rollers, warped tracks, or accumulated debris can cause the door to derail.
Is it possible to improve energy efficiency with sliding door repairs? Yes, fixing issues like gaps or damaged seals can help reduce drafts and improve insulation.
